Danya DeLeon

Danya DeLeon is a Rockport and Native Texan silversmith jewelry artist. She began metal work in 2016 when she was introduced to a local artist who taught her foundational skills. She fell in love with the craft.

Danya considers herself a student always as she pursues knowledge through her journey in silversmithing. She finds inspiration in the natural world around her by using raw and/ natural stones, fossils, shells, and other natural materials. She mainly works in silver but also loves working with copper, brass and bronze. She has an affinity for adding decorative texture and contrast through forming, and reticulation. Reticulation is a process in metalwork that basically uses heat to create a new surface on the metal.  Danya utilizes her intuition, allowing the metal and material to dictate their final forms.
